Output 6d76d6305db43b4fd893b7c37419cb7382be7b72454406523920c994a693734b:30

value
3980131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d25b89b2cfba2388a655201940e423631b0239 OP_EQUAL
address
3Nv4gwyLjJe4AYe2RZEaV6JWQTKF5ENik2
transaction
6d76d6305db43b4fd893b7c37419cb7382be7b72454406523920c994a693734b